N.J. Crews Hit Bar Blaze

The Borough of Folsom Volunteer Fire Department in Atlantic County, N.J. was dispatched to 1118 Black Horse Pike, the Horsin' Around Bar & Grill.

The call was for a report of smoke in the basement of a two-story wood-frame structure with an attached 50 x 50 one-story addition on the "C" side.

Crews found heavy smoke and fire in the basement with extension to the upper floors. The fire escalated, and required the response of 16 fire companies due to the lack of water.

Most of the companies were part of a water tender task force, responding from Atlantic, Camden, and Gloucester counties.

The cause of the fire was determined to be a fuel leak in the basement.
